How we track insider buying in SKYH

We continuously poll SEC EDGAR for new Form 4 filings and parse every open-market purchase (transaction code P). A cluster is recorded when two or more distinct insiders — officers, directors, or 10% owners — each buy SKYH within a rolling window. We track clusters at every company size, from micro-caps to mega-caps. Every figure on this page traces back to an official filing; open any row to jump straight to the source document.
